When you attempt to open or download a Microsoft Office document (.doc file, .xls file, .ppt file, and so on) from a secure Web site in Internet Explorer, you may receive one of the following error messages
Cause:
This is because the response has no-cache header which prevents the office document being cached in IE.
However, When IE communicates with a secure Web site through SSL, it enforces any no-cache request. If the header or headers are present, IE does not cache the file. Consequently, Office cannot open the file.
Resolution:
Remove the no-cache header from response.
